#3f6986 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3f6986 is composed of 24.7% red, 41.2%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53% cyan, 21.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 204.5 degrees, a saturation of 36% and a lightness of 38.6%. #3f6986 color hex could be obtained by blending #7ed2ff with #00000d.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#3f6986 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#3f6986 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3f6986 has RGB values of R:63, G:105,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 4155782.

Shades and Tints of #3f6986
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f2f6f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3f6986
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d6368 is the less saturated color, while #0274c3 is the most saturated one.
